What to Look For When Choosing a TV Mount?

Before you make a choice, there are a few technical specifications you need to check. This ensures the mount is compatible with your TV and can be securely attached to the wall.

1. VESA Size: The Foundation of Compatibility

The VESA size is the standardised distance between the four mounting holes on the back of your television. It is expressed in millimetres (width x height), for example, 200x200 mm. Every TV wall mount is designed for specific VESA sizes. You can find your TV's VESA size in the user manual, on the manufacturer's website, or by measuring the distance between the holes yourself. Ensure your TV's VESA size matches the mount's specifications.

2. Mount Type: Fixed, Tilting, or Full-Motion?

TV mounts come in three main types, each with its own advantages:

  • Fixed TV Mount (Flat): This mount positions your TV as close to the wall as possible, often with only a few centimetres of space in between. This creates a minimalist and clean look. A fixed TV mount is ideal if you always sit directly in front of the TV and aren't bothered by glare from lights or windows.
  • Tilting TV Mount: This allows you to tilt the TV vertically, usually by about 10 to 15 degrees. This is useful if the TV is mounted higher on the wall, such as in a bedroom, or to reduce annoying reflections from windows or lamps.
  • Full-Motion TV Mount (Swivel): For maximum flexibility, choose a full-motion TV mount. This swivel TV mount can not only tilt but also turn left and right. It's perfect for open-plan living spaces or rooms with multiple seating areas, ensuring an optimal viewing experience from any angle.

3. Weight Capacity and Wall Construction

Always check the maximum weight capacity of the TV mounting bracket. This weight must be greater than the weight of your television. Additionally, it is crucial to attach the mount to a sturdy, load-bearing wall. Walls made of concrete or solid brick are generally suitable. For hollow walls (like drywall), you will need specialised anchors and extra caution. When in doubt, consult a professional.

Frequently Asked Questions About TV Mounts

How do I know my TV's VESA size?

The VESA size is usually listed in your TV's manual or on the manufacturer's product page. You can also measure it yourself: measure the horizontal and vertical distance (in millimetres) between the centre of the mounting holes on the back of your TV.

Can a TV wall mount be installed on any wall?

No, safety is paramount. A television wall mount must be installed on a sturdy, load-bearing wall made of materials like concrete, solid brick, or with wooden studs. Mounting on a hollow wall like drywall is not recommended unless you use special, appropriate anchors and reinforcements. Always verify that the wall can support the combined weight of the TV and the mount.

What is the ideal height for a TV mount?

A good rule of thumb is to hang the TV so that the centre of the screen is at eye level when you are seated on your sofa. This is typically around 100 to 110 cm from the floor. However, this can vary depending on the size of your TV and your personal preference.
